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Mrs Sheena Harripershad is NOT enrolled with medicare and thus cannot prescribe medicare part D drugs to patients with medicare part D benefits.

FDA AAC recommends approval of Pfizer's tofacitinib for RA

Pfizer Inc. announced today that the Arthritis Advisory Committee to the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) voted 8-2 to recommend approval of the investigational agent tofacitinib for the treatment of adult patients with moderately to severely active rheumatoid arthritis.

First placebo-controlled clinical study results of BYETTA injection with Lantus presented at ADA 2010

Amylin Pharmaceuticals, Inc. and Eli Lilly and Company today announced results from the first double-blind, placebo-controlled clinical study to evaluate BYETTA (exenatide) injection added to Lantus (insulin glargine), which showed patients with type 2 diabetes achieved glucose targets without weight gain or increasing their risk of hypoglycemia. These findings were presented at the 70th Annual Scientific Sessions of the American Diabetes Association in Orlando, Fla.

Study: Baseball players experience disrupted sleep patterns and fatigue during major league seasons

Strike zone judgment grows worse over the course of a Major League Baseball season in a predictable way, possibly due to the effect of grueling travel schedules, disrupted sleep patterns and fatigue, a Vanderbilt University Medical Center sleep researcher reports at a national meeting this week.
